A nonviolent musical 3D Platformer The land of Groovy Hue was once bursting with music and color until the Great Slumber. Take control of Newt, a new tone in this musical land. Awakening this sleeping, silent world is Newt's rite of passage. Restore music, life, and color to the your world!

Reviews: Mixed — 64% — of 87 reviews
Released: 2019-09-06
Developer: DevNAri
Publisher: Whitethorn Games
Genres: Action, Adventure, Casual, Indie
Platforms: Windows, Mac
